  • What is S.A.D.? (Life Topic #2)
    2024/03/01

    S.A.D. is a really sad and appropriate acronym for Seasonal Affective Disorder. S.A.D. has a lot in common with and can turn into depression, but it also has some distinct differences. Hi, I'm Dawn, and I struggle with S.A.D. Join me today as we learn more about this mental health issue, things that help, when to be concerned, and much more. I'm excited to share with you my experience and continue to offer the thought that mental health, like physical health, is something that should be discussed openly and honestly, not secretively and shamefully.   • Intro to Taper
    2024/02/09

    Tapering. That glorious and yet dreaded time when you get to cut the miles, clean up the loose ends, and prepare for race day...by not doing much. It's a weird thing mentally. Where in most things in life you cram at the end preparing for our most important races are just the opposite. Come along and we discuss the critical role that tapering has in giving you the best possible experience on race day.
